DETAILED DESCRIPTION OF THE INVENTION I) Technical Field Currently, in excavator rotation in underground boring, mountain stoppers, boring boring of anchor bolt holes, boring of piping holes for upper, sewer, electricity, gas, etc. The drilling head of the propulsion spindle is attached, and the steel pipes or rods are connected one after another as the drilling progresses (the drilling head is attached to the leading steel pipe or rod) for long-distance boring. The present invention relates to a structure of an excavating head used for the above boring.

II) ... Problems of the prior art (1) ... Conventionally, in the boring operation as described above, when the steel pipes or rods are connected one after another while the excavation is in progress, the bit of the tip drilling head is worn. When the efficiency of cutting is reduced or it becomes impossible to perform cutting, at the position of the excavator, pull back the steel pipes or rods one by one, pull them back and replace the excavating head at the tip with a new one, and then Alternatively, the rods were connected one by one and inserted to the original cutting position, and the cutting was finally resumed.

(2) Therefore, the longer the cutting distance is, the more labor and time are required for exchanging the excavating head, which is the greatest bottleneck in improving work efficiency and shortening work time.

Also, since the wear endurance time of the bit changes depending on the soil and rock quality, proper management of the excavating head, such as grasping the wear state of the bit and deciding when to replace the excavating head, is always a heavy burden on the operator. It was what was.

III) ... Means for Solving the Problems The present invention has succeeded in effectively solving the above-mentioned conventional problems.

(1) That is, the present invention is a steel pipe type excavating head which is set on the rotary propulsion main shaft of an excavator and performs boring. Drilled,
Following the first step, second to nth windows are bored at equal intervals in the axial direction, bits are fixed to the tip of the tubular body at equal intervals, and
The problem is solved by a drilling head for boring, in which a bit is fixedly installed in each of the windows from the stage to the n-th stage.

IV) Embodiment (1) The following will describe an embodiment of the present invention with reference to the drawings. It is a steel pipe type drilling head A for boring by setting it on a rotary propulsion spindle of an excavator (not shown). On the circumferential surface of the body 1, first-stage windows 2 are provided at equal intervals in the circumferential direction, and second-stage to n-th windows 2 are provided at equal intervals in the axial direction following the first step. Then, the bits 3 are fixed to the tip end surface of the tubular body 1 at equal intervals, and the bits 3 are fixed to the bottom portion 4 in each of the windows 2 of the first to n-th steps to form the boring head A for boring. It is provided.

(2) Thus, the excavating head A is arranged so that the bit 3 fixed in the window 2 of the next stage is exposed in order before the bit 3 fixed in the window 2 of the previous stage is worn away by the excavation. The tube 1
The window 2 is arranged on the peripheral surface, and the bit 3 is fixed in the window.

(3) The bit 3 is fixed to the bottom portion 4 of each window 2 by, for example, rotting or welding.

V) ... Actions and effects (1) ... When the excavating head of the present invention having the above-mentioned configuration is attached to an excavator and boring is performed, when the bit of the first stage is worn, the bit of the second stage appears and the second stage is excavated. When the bit of No. 3 wears out, the bit of the 3rd stage appears, and new bits of the next stage appear up to the nth stage one after another to excavate, so there is no need to replace the excavation head even for long distance drilling or hard ground drilling. You can continue to work, and you can be extremely effective.

(2) Therefore, it is unnecessary to replace and manage the excavating head as in the conventional case, and the conventional problem can be effectively solved.

(3) As described above, according to the excavating head of the present invention, the longer the distance is excavated and the harder the ground is excavated, the more the characteristics can be exhibited, which is much more advantageous than the conventional one, and the work can be performed easily. It is possible to realize a great reduction in personnel and work costs.
